the BMI was a system use for rough indications
underweigh= at risk about 2x for vitamin defiencies and some malnutrition syndromes

normal= average risk

overweight = 2 x risk normal of Cardiovascular disease..

obese = 10 x risk normal of cardiovascular disease..

its sumfing lik tat ...

the normal 20-25 range is based on a caucasian study

the East asian one.. is lik 18-23.. and is based on a hong kong study.. those of african descent its normal is higher (? 20-26) due to bone and muscle density

the BMI is realli a screening tool not a definative test... like body builders with BMI = obese.. have lik lean body masses of <5% when most normal ppl are lik 10-20% for males..
